1、使用cat /etc/redhatrelease
:
该命令会打印出CentOS的发行版本号和发行时间,输出可能显示“CentOS Linux release 7.9.2009 (Core)”。
2、使用lsb_release a
:
如果系统中已安装了lsb_release
包,可以使用此命令查看详细的系统信息,包括发行版本号和代号,输出可能包含“Distributor ID: CentOS”、“Description: CentOS Linux release 7.9.2009 (Core)”等详细信息。
3、使用hostnamectl
:
这个命令可以显示CentOS的版本以及操作系统的相关信息,输出可能包含“Operating System: CentOS Linux 7 (Core)”。
4、使用rpm q centosrelease
:
该命令会显示更详细的CentOS版本信息,输出可能显示“centosrelease79.2009.0.el7.centos.x86_64”。
5、使用uname a
:
该命令可以查看Linux内核的信息和版本号,输出可能显示“Linux 主机名 4.19.08.el7.x86_64 #1 SMP Tue Oct 22 19:31:00 EDT 2019 x86_64 x86_64 x86_64 GNU/Linux”。
6、使用getenforce
:
该命令可以查看CentOS当前的版本号,输出可能显示“Enforcing”。
7、查看/PRoc/version
:
这是一个关于Linux内核的文件,可以查看CentOS的版本号,输出可能显示“Linux version 3.10.0693.el7.x86_64”。
8、使用yum list installed
:
该命令可以查看当前已安装的软件,并将其与CentOS版本号关联起来,从而完成任务。
方法 | 描述 | 示例输出 |
cat /etc/redhatrelease | 打印出CentOS的发行版本号和发行时间 | “CentOS Linux release 7.9.2009 (Core)” |
lsb_release a | 查看详细的系统信息,包括发行版本号和代号 | “Distributor ID: CentOS”、“Description: CentOS Linux release 7.9.2009 (Core)” |
hostnamectl | 显示CentOS的版本以及操作系统的相关信息 | “Operating System: CentOS Linux 7 (Core)” |
rpm q centosrelease | 显示更详细的CentOS版本信息 | “centosrelease79.2009.0.el7.centos.x86_64” |
uname a | 查看Linux内核的信息和版本号 | “Linux 主机名 4.19.08.el7.x86_64” |
getenforce | 查看CentOS当前的版本号 | “Enforcing” |
/proc/version | 查看Linux内核的文件,可以查看CentOS的版本号 | “Linux version 3.10.0693.el7.x86_64” |
yum list installed | 查看当前已安装的软件,并将其与CentOS版本号关联起来,从而完成任务 |
常见问题解答
Q1: 如何确定我的CentOS版本?
A1: 你可以使用以下几种方法中的任意一种来确定你的CentOS版本:
cat /etc/redhatrelease lsb_release a hostnamectl rpm q centosrelease uname a
这些命令都会提供关于你当前使用的CentOS版本的信息。
Q2: 如何升级到最新的CentOS版本?
A2: 要升级到最新的CentOS版本,你可以按照以下步骤操作:
1、确保你的系统是最新的:
sudo yum update y
2、安装CentOSSCLo(软件集合)以获取最新版本的软件包:
sudo yum install centosreleasescl y
3、启用最新的CentOS存储库:
sudo yum enablerepo=centossclorh enable centossclorh
4、再次更新系统:
sudo yum update y
通过以上步骤,你可以将你的CentOS系统升级到最新的版本。